Title : Dna2 of Saccharomyces cerevisiae possesses a single-stranded DNA-specific endonuclease activity that is able to act on double-stranded DNA in the presence of ATP.

1 ATP and dATP, the only nucleotides hydrolyzed by Dna2, served to stimulate Dna2 to utilize duplex DNA, indicating their hydrolysis is required. 2'-deoxyadenosine triphosphate bifunctional ATP-dependent DNA helicase/ssDNA endodeoxyribonuclease DNA2 Saccharomyces cerevisiae S288C
